Abstract:
The present invention provides a sensing system and method for providing information relating to a drivetrain during shifting operations. The drivetrain includes an engine, a torque converter and a transmission. The system includes sensors for detecting the output speed of the engine, the output speed of the torque converter, and the output speed of the transmission. The system detects the starting condition of a shifting operation, responsively determines a set of performance parameters, and produces a set of performance parameter signals.
